Michael Leyrat-Savin, PGE 2013 Global Strategy Director at BIC

Michael Leyrat-Savin, a graduate of Grenoble École de Management, has recently been appointed Global Strategy Director for BIC's Lighter division. He is responsible for defining and steering the global strategy of this division, the world leader in its market.


Since March 2025, Michael has overseen the development of the division's three-year strategic plan, based on in-depth internal and external analysis. He identifies priority growth levers across the different regions, designs local roadmaps, and works closely with the M&A teams to evaluate development opportunities.

Prior to this appointment, Michael was Global Senior Strategy Manager at BIC, which he joined in January 2023. He was also Strategy Manager at Intermarché, where he helped define the Group's strategic plan and structure cross-functional projects.

His career also includes several experiences in strategy consulting, notably with Nova Consulting and Wavestone.



About Bic

Founded in 1945 by Marcel Bich, BIC is a French group globally recognized for its everyday products: pens, stationery items, razors, lighters, and sporting goods. The company, headquartered in Clichy, remains under the control of the founding family
